Web4 jan. 2024 · 200 days/5 = 40. Take the 40 and multiply it by your daily remuneration, which is R164.38. The answer is R6575.2 as your claim. In addition, if you are paid by the hour, you should add the last (6) six-month salary together and then divide by (6) six. Apply the same method to your UIF contributions. WebAs a UIF contributor, you qualify for a maternity benefit of between 38% and 58% of your salary, depending on your earnings. If your salary is R12,478 or more, you’ll get R155.89 per day or R4,676 a month. If you earn R5,000, you’ll get around R72.96 per day or …

When teaching finance to learners it is important that you show learners as many different examples of where VAT is used in documents and to use different examples of payslips to calculate the UIF deduction. hr summit dubai 2022WebThe income from UIF claims for employees are based on their daily rate (.i.e. earnings). The employee can claim one day’s worth of income for every six days that they have worked. This amount can accumulate to a maximum of 365 days (one year) over 4 years of continued employment.
